Last weekend I finally went on a trip to the big city! I made a small, crappy after movie for you to check out in the video folder.

I left Cambridge around 2:30pm from Addenbrooke's to go to the NationalExpress bus that would bring me to London. I was very lucky and booked a return ticket for only six quid (British slang for pounds.., I should be the symbol of integration). When I got in the bus bringing me to the bus that would take me to London - you still following? - I had a major bus 12 déja vu as suddenly at the next stop about 30 students marched in.. The NationalExpress bus was quite good however, with comfy chairs and a friendly bus driver.

When I arrived in London (it took about one hour to get from the suburbs to the centre) I got out at Embankment, right next to the London Eye and Big Ben! I was really happy to be in the big city again. The people, the buzzing, the energy, it all made me feel like I could finally breathe again. I would meet up with my friends of the master's program - Lucie and Isabelle (living in London), Julie (Berlin), and Rebeca (Amsterdam) - for dinner at the Pizza Express. I got the address from Lucie but as I was trying to find the restaurant my battery died and I had to use my own instincts... After a slight detour via Waterloo I actually found the place and I was the first to arrive even! The other girls joined it slightly later and soon it felt like we hadn't seen each other for two weeks instead of two months. After dinner we went to the theater, as we got tickets for the play 'The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Nighttime'. I read this book in my third year of high school (8th grade) so I was particularly excited to see it! When we arrived at the National Theater - which was right next to the pizza place - we found out we had to be at a different venue.... which was a 20-25 min walk from there !! So fast-speed walking through London to the right place, at Piccadilly, where we had to wait a few minutes before we could enter. We were not the only ones who were late though, so that made it less awkward.. The play was really really good! The stage was very impressive, with a lot of technical stuff, and they even god a REAL PUPPY on stage - crowd went wild. I would definitely recommend it!

After the play Lucie and I went for a drink in town with some of her friends. By that time rain poured down.. but thank god I got an umbrella with me. Before we went home we went to someone's place for another glass of wine and we ordered and uber (taxi) to get us there. The driver was an absolute disaster, constantly speeding and breaking, which made us all too sick for wine for at least half an hour.. (we gave him a 2 star rating.. there you go!). The next day Lucie and I woke up around noon and went for brunch/lunch at Borough Market. Sooo much food!! There was food from all different nationalities and it was all delicious <3 We also bought a vanilla cheesecake with brownie base (hehe, jealous already, Finte?) as a dessert for later. After we went to the (speed)boat that would bring us to Greenwich. Apparently they determined the different time zones there - you know, the +1, -1 stuff - which of course I did not know about. An example of my lack of general knowledge.. again.

In Greenwich we met up with Julie and Isabelle. The weather was quite nice, with even some sun (the yellow thing in the sky that you normally only observe in the south of Europe). We all went back together to Lucie's place for some self-made dinner - pasta with Lucie's mushrooms and an insane amount of vegetables... I am not naming anyone but it starts with J(ulie). Rebeca joined in at dinner too and after we went for a night out to Blues Kitchen, a bar in Brixton. Apart from the 10£ entrance and the crazy expensive drinks (UK prices) it was a nice evening. There was even a band on the second floor! The next morning/day Lucie and I enjoyed a lovely morning breakfast with two of our friends, named Ben & Jerry. After we went for a real English breakfast with bacon and eggs at a small cake place somewhere in town with the other girls. Unfortunately we had to say goodbye to them as they had to catch their planes back home.. To comfort ourselves after the heartbreak Lucie and I both bought a new perfume which appeared to be immensely discounted when we went to pay - BAM! As we had not eaten that much yet we went to Yo Sushi at Victoria Station before I had to take the bus back home too.

London was entertaining and good, it has been nice to be away for the weekend. However, I was also glad to back in Cambridge again. It does start to feel like home. Especially the clear air, the piece and the adorable housing. I was not even irritated by the absence of any public transport at 9pm.... Yeah Cambridge, a real 'city' you are..haha!
